But in a move Hall said was meant to cut down on unemployment fraud, ID.me began using facial verification at state unemployment agencies in November 2020 starting with California, where fraud was such a big problem that the statestopped processing new benefit applicationsfor two weeks in September and October 2020. In 2013, under the name ID.me,it started offering the same service to more groups, including students and first responders, and it has moved more deeply into identity authentication services at government agencies since then. Users, according to itsprivacy policy, can ask ID.me to delete personally identifiable information it has gathered from them, but the company may keep track of certain information if required by law and may not be able to completely delete all user information since it periodically backs up such data.
